The stay order passed by the Supreme Court in Nagla Machi jhuggi case  
(2nd May 06), in response to the Special leave Petition filed (on  
26th April 06) by Advocate Prashant Bhusan is attached. Supreme Court  
has stopped the demolition of jhuggis of Nangla Machi which was going  
to be demolished by MCD/Slum & JJ department in pursuant to the  
direction of the Delhi High Court (5th April 06). The Case is again  
coming for hearing on 9th May 2006.

SUPREME COURT OF INDIA
RECORD OF PROCEEDINGS

Petition (s) for Specail Leave to Appeal (Civil) ………/2006
Cc 3732/2006
(From the judgement and order dated 05.04.2006 in WP No. 3419/1999 of  
the High Court of Delhi at N. Delhi)

RAM RATAN &ORS. Petitioner (s)

Versus

COMMR. OF DELHI POLICE & ORS. Respondent (s)

(With appln(s) for permission to file SLP and prayer for interim  
relief and office report)

Date: 02/05/2006 This Petition was called on for mentioning today.

Coram: Hon’ble Mrs. Justice Ruma Pal
Hon’ble Mr. Justice Dalveer Bhandari

For Petitioner (s) Mr. Prashant Bhushan, Adv.
Mr. Rohit Kumar Singh, Adv.
Mr. Sumit Sharma, Adv.
Ms. Parul Kaur Majethia, adv.
Ms. Indira Unninayar, adv.


For Respondent(s)

UPON being mentioned the Court made the following
ORDER

List on due date.
Stay of the impugned order in so far as the demolition is concerned.
